Output 1695041bf21e067d463b7fd52029ce1c4b0f5bf9fb11e7d9d403dd0f17c8c051:12

value
27383463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5c1d1f3b1b23e57f6272a84cdf05b452ae609b OP_EQUAL
address
MQtYGHar8kK5jMDpUzmK321QpPdcTdxXGk
transaction
1695041bf21e067d463b7fd52029ce1c4b0f5bf9fb11e7d9d403dd0f17c8c051
spent
true